1. Display

When choosing a tablet for digital art, the display is one of the most important factors to consider. A high-resolution display will allow you to see your artwork in great detail, and it will also make it easier to work on fine details. There are a few things to keep in mind when considering the display of a tablet for digital art:

  • Resolution: The resolution of a display is measured in pixels per inch (ppi). The higher the resolution, the more detailed your artwork will appear. For digital art, a resolution of at least 2560 x 1440 is recommended.
  • Color accuracy: The color accuracy of a display is important for ensuring that your artwork looks its best. A display with good color accuracy will reproduce colors accurately, without any distortion or color shifting.
  • Viewing angle: The viewing angle of a display is the angle at which you can view the display without any loss of color or contrast. A display with a wide viewing angle will allow you to view your artwork from different angles without any distortion.

In addition to these factors, you may also want to consider the size of the display. A larger display will give you more room to work, but it will also be more expensive and less portable. A smaller display will be more portable, but it will also give you less room to work.

2. Stylus

The stylus is an essential part of any digital art tablet. It is the tool that you will use to create your artwork, so it is important to choose one that is comfortable to use and that provides you with the control and precision that you need.

  • Pressure sensitivity: The pressure sensitivity of a stylus is one of the most important factors to consider. The higher the pressure sensitivity, the more control you will have over the thickness and opacity of your brushstrokes. This is important for creating realistic-looking artwork, as it allows you to vary the pressure of your strokes to create different effects.
  • Tip type: The type of tip that your stylus uses can also affect the way that you draw. There are two main types of tips: hard tips and soft tips. Hard tips are more durable and can be used to create sharp, precise lines. Soft tips are more flexible and can be used to create softer, more blended lines.
  • Size and shape: The size and shape of your stylus can also affect the way that you draw. A larger stylus will give you more control, but it can also be more tiring to use. A smaller stylus will be more portable, but it can be more difficult to control. The shape of your stylus can also affect the way that you draw. A stylus with a pointed tip will allow you to create more precise lines, while a stylus with a rounded tip will allow you to create softer, more blended lines.

4. Software

The software that you use with your tablet is an important part of your digital art workflow. It can affect the way that you create your artwork, as well as the final quality of your artwork. There are a variety of different software programs available,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. It is important to choose a software program that is compatible with your tablet and that meets your needs.

  • Compatibility: The first thing to consider when choosing a software program for digital art is compatibility. Make sure that the software program is compatible with your tablet. Not all software programs are compatible with all tablets, so it is important to check before you purchase a software program.
  • Features: Once you have checked compatibility, you can start to consider the features that you need in a software program. Different software programs offer different features, so it is important to choose a software program that has the features that you need. For example, if you are planning on creating raster-based artwork, then you will need a software program that supports raster graphics. If you are planning on creating vector-based artwork, then you will need a software program that supports vector graphics.
  • Price: Price is another important factor to consider when choosing a software program for digital art. Software programs can range in price from free to hundreds of dollars. It is important to set a budget before you start shopping for a software program so that you do not overspend.

Question 1: What are the key factors to consider when choosing a tablet for digital art?

When selecting a tablet for digital art, crucial factors to consider include display size and resolution, pressure sensitivity, stylus compatibility, software compatibility, operating system, brand reputation, and available accessories.

Question 2: What display size is optimal for digital art?

The ideal display size depends on your workflow and preferences. Larger displays (12 inches or more) offer ample space for detailed work, while smaller displays (10 inches or less) are more portable and suitable for quick sketches or on-the-go drawing.

Question 3: How important is pressure sensitivity in a stylus?

Pressure sensitivity is crucial for mimicking traditional drawing techniques. Higher pressure sensitivity allows for precise control over brushstrokes, enabling you to vary line thickness and opacity naturally, enhancing the realism and expressiveness of your digital artwork.

Question 4: What software is compatible with most digital art tablets?

Leading digital art software such as Adobe Photoshop, Procreate, and Clip Studio Paint are compatible with a wide range of tablets. Check the software’s system requirements to ensure compatibility with your chosen tablet before purchasing.

Question 5: Which operating system is better for digital art, iOS or Android?

Both iOS and Android offer dedicated digital art apps and features. iOS tends to have a wider selection of professional-grade apps, while Android provides more customization options and budget-friendly choices. Ultimately, the choice depends on your preferred workflow and app ecosystem.

Question 6: How do I choose a reputable brand for my digital art tablet?

Research reputable brands known for producing high-quality art tools. Read reviews, compare product specifications, and consider factors such as warranty, customer support, and industry recognition to make an informed decision.

Tips for Choosing the Best Tablet for Digital Art

Selecting the ideal digital art tablet requires careful consideration of various factors. Here are some valuable tips to guide your decision-making process:

Tip 1: Prioritize Display Quality

The display is the canvas for your digital artwork. Opt for a tablet with a high-resolution screen that accurately reproduces colors, ensuring vibrant and detailed visuals. Consider factors like screen size, resolution, and color accuracy to find a display that meets your artistic needs.

Tip 2: Evaluate Stylus Performance

The stylus is the tool that translates your hand movements into digital strokes. Look for a stylus with high pressure sensitivity for precise control over line thickness and opacity. Additional features like tilt sensitivity and programmable buttons can enhance your drawing experience.

Tip 3: Consider Software Compatibility

Ensure that the tablet you select is compatible with your preferred digital art software. Check the software’s system requirements and verify that the tablet supports the necessary features and operating system. This compatibility ensures seamless integration and optimal performance.

Tip 4: Explore Connectivity Options

Consider the connectivity options available on the tablet. If you plan on using the tablet with a computer or other devices, ensure that it supports the necessary wired or wireless connections. Bluetooth connectivity, for example, allows for convenient wireless pairing with other devices.

Tip 5: Assess Portability and Ergonomics

If portability is important, choose a lightweight and compact tablet that is easy to carry around. Consider the tablet’s ergonomics, such as the grip and weight distribution, to ensure comfortable use during extended drawing sessions.
